A trainer is teaching a dolphin to do tricks. The probability that the dolphin successfully performs the trick is 8 out of 24 attempts.

What are the mean and standard deviation

1 answer

The probability of success, p, is 8/24 = 1/3.
The probability of failure, q, is 1 - p = 2/3.

The mean, or expected value, is given by E(X) = np = (24)(1/3) = 8.

The standard deviation is given by σ = sqrt(npq) = sqrt((24)(1/3)(2/3)) ≈ 2.05.
